The move provides the company with almost twice the square footage of its previous offices and was made necessary by 100 percent growth in staff over the last 12 months. At the same time, Aelita opened its first European office in Reading, United Kingdom, and announced its intention to open a second European office in Germany. The company named Malcolm Etchells as managing director for Europe, Middle East and Africa. Etchells will establish and oversee a sales and service structure to accelerate the company's international growth.
